“Have a Coke has become a gracious custom in more than 100 countries of the world today.”
During 1957, artist Jack Potter created ten illustrations for Coca Cola‘s “100 countries” ad campaign.
- Sun Valley pauses for a Coca-Cola, as the talented brush of artist Jack Potter records the welcome moment.
- The talent of Jack Potter’s brush visits a pleasant home overlooking famous Diamond Head.
- “Under the sun of the Caribbees, talented Jack Potter pictures a cheerful pause for Coca-Cola.”
- “Enjoyment of the world-famous pause is captured for you at a Paris cafe by artist Jack Potter.”
- “A famous Canadian resort inspires another interpretation from the talented brush of Jack Potter.”
- “A scene on the sunny coast of France inspires another interpretation from the brush of Jack Potter.”
- “An outing on the grand canal inspires another interpretation by talented young artist Jack Potter.”
- “A famed gathering-place in the German Black Forest inspires another interpretation by talented Jack Potter.”
- “From a Maharaja’s Palace in far-off India comes another interpretation from the brush of young Jack Potter.”
